Greek city-states were primarily run by their **citizens**. In many city-states, particularly Athens, a system of direct democracy allowed eligible citizens to participate in decision-making and governance. While some city-states had kings or were governed by a select group of politicians, the most influential and representative systems were rooted in the involvement of citizens.
